memphisbasshead Posted July 24, 2010 Report Share Posted July 24, 2010 http://cgi.ebay.com/PLANET-AUDIO-TQ1601D-1600-W-CLASS-D-MONO-AMP-AMPLIFIER-/380228884088?cmd=ViewItem&pt=Car_Amplifiers&hash=item5887685678 I saw this amp and it looked like a hell of a deal for the price. I was wondering if it was any good or if its just a POS. I did notice in one of the pics in the ebay description that it had 4 35 amp fuses and it is a class d amp so thats %70 percent efficiency. so 35x4=140 amps 140x14.4=2016 watts 2016x0.70=1411.2 watts and they rate the amp to put out 1200 watts rms @ 1 ohm but it looks like it would put out just a little bit more than that if so then this is a kick ass amp for the price. but you have to consider that when you turn your subs up you get some voltage drop(on most cars) so lets estimate around 13 volts so thats 13x140=1820 watts 1820x0.7=1274 watts rms.
